The PCE-ET 3000 Earth Resistance Meter is a specialized device designed for accurately measuring the resistance of the earth, also known as ground resistance.
The earth tester is utilized for assessing the grounding systems or lightning-arresters in various structures. Encased in a hermetic housing, it meets all safety standards outlined in VDE 0413 for technical service providers. This tester is suitable for evaluating ground electrodes, lightning-arresters, or small grounding systems, and can also be employed for measuring power resistance, conductive components, and coupling elements.
| Technical specifications | |||
| Functions | Range | Resolution | Accuracy |
| Earth resistance | 0 … 19.99/ 0 … 199/ y 0 … 1999 Ω |
10/ 100 mΩ / 1 Ω | ± 2% + 2 positions |
| AC Stress | 0 … 200 V AC 50/60 Hz |
0,1 V | ± 3% + 2 positions |
| Lower measurement limit. | 0.01 Ω | ||
| Current of measurement | 2 mAeff / rms | ||
| Response time | aprox. 2.5 s | ||
| Measuring quota | 4 s | ||
| Frequency | 820 Hz | ||
| Overload range | in case of overlaoad, „1“ is shown | ||
| Power | 6 x 1.5 V batteries | ||
| Dimensions | 160 x 120 x 65 mm | ||
| Weight | 560 g | ||
| Safety | IEC- 1010- 1; EN 61010- 1 installation category: III |
||
| EMV | EN 50081- 1; EN 50082- 1 corresp. DIN/ VDE 0413 part 7 |
